Private-sector healthcare scales up across India’s Northeast as rising patient demand meets advanced, multi-specialty infrastructure. Agartala (Tripura) [India], July 23: TripuraSantiniketan Medical College & Hospital, operated by the West Bengal-based Swadhin Trust, is advancing one of the Northeast’s most ambitious private healthcare projects: a major multi-modality hospital on the outskirts of Agartala that is set to become the largest privately operated multi-specialty hospital in Tripura. The development marks a significant step in bringing advanced, multi-specialty medical care closer to the people of Tripura and the wider Northeast.
